How To Choose The Best Booster Pads For Adults

Choosing the right booster pad is a balancing act between absorbency, fit, and comfort. A pad that’s too thin won’t prevent leaks, while one that’s poorly shaped can bunch up and cause irritation. Focus on these key attributes to find your ideal match.

Absorbent Capacity: Fluid Volume & Core Material

The most critical spec is how much fluid the pad can hold. Look for claims in ounces or milliliters — a good overnight booster should handle at least 10 ounces (around 300 mL). Pads with a high ratio of super absorbent polymer (SAP) to fluff pulp swell into a gel upon contact, locking moisture away from the skin and reducing odor. This is far more effective than pads that rely only on thick cotton padding, which can feel bulky and soggy.

Dimensions and Fit Profile

Length and width determine how well a booster sits inside your diaper or protective underwear. A pad that is too short will leave the front or back exposed, while one that is too wide can fold over the leg gathers, causing leaks. Typical adult booster lengths range from 12 to 18.5 inches. Narrower profiles (around 4 inches) fit better inside pull-ups, while wider ones (around 5 inches) are better suited for tab-style briefs.

Adhesive Strip and Skin Comfort

A strong, strategically placed adhesive strip is essential to keep the pad from shifting during movement or sleep. The best strips run the full length of the pad or are placed in the center to anchor it securely. For skin health, especially with overnight use, choose pads with a soft, non-woven top sheet that wicks moisture away. Fragrance-free, latex-free, and chlorine-free materials are safer for sensitive skin and reduce the risk of rashes.

FAQ

Can I use a baby diaper booster pad for an adult?
Yes, many adult users do this to save money. Pads like the Medline booster are technically designed for babies but function identically in adult diapers. The main trade-offs are a smaller width, which can shift in a pull-up, and a lower total absorbency per pad. They work best when 2-3 are used together in a tab-style brief for overnight protection.
How do I stop a booster pad from bunching up?
Bunching is usually caused by poor adhesion or a pad that is too wide for the diaper. Ensure the booster has a strong, full-length adhesive strip and press it firmly into the center of the diaper. Using a narrower pad (around 4 inches wide) inside pull-ups helps prevent the edges from folding over the leg gathers, which is a primary cause of bunching.
